SD安卓站安卓市场是中国最大的安卓(android)应用绿色下载平台。
当前位置: 首页 > 资讯 > SD专栏

以太坊的公私钥,以太坊公私钥生成机制解析

来源:小编 更新:2025-01-11 04:24:24

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

想象你手中握有一把神秘的钥匙,这把钥匙能够打开一个数字世界的宝库。而这把钥匙,就是以太坊的公私钥。今天,就让我们一起揭开这把钥匙的神秘面纱,探索它背后的故事和奥秘。

数字世界的守护者:公私钥的诞生

在以太坊的世界里,公私钥就像是一对双胞胎,它们共同守护着你的数字资产。公钥,就像你的名字,公开透明,任何人都可以看到;而私钥,则是你的身份证,只有你才能拥有。

公私钥的生成,源于一个神奇的算法——椭圆曲线数字签名算法(ECDSA)。这个算法,将你的私钥转换成公钥,再通过一系列复杂的计算,最终生成你的地址。这个过程,就像是在数字世界中,为你打造了一个独一无二的身份证。

揭秘公私钥的生成过程

那么,公私钥究竟是如何生成的呢?让我们一起揭开这个神秘的面纱。

第一步:私钥的诞生

私钥,就像是一串神秘的密码,由256位的16进制字符组成。它是随机生成的,就像宇宙中的星辰,独一无二。这串密码,将成为你进入数字世界的通行证。

第二步:公钥的诞生

私钥生成后,通过椭圆曲线数字签名算法,被转换成公钥。公钥由65个字节组成,其中前两个字节是固定的,后面的63个字节则是私钥的映射。这个公钥,就像你的名字,公开透明,任何人都可以看到。

第三步:地址的诞生

公钥生成后,通过Keccak-256哈希算法,计算出公钥的哈希值。取这个哈希值的后20个字节,就得到了你的地址。这个地址,就像你的身份证号码,唯一且不可复制。

公私钥的神奇之处

公私钥,就像是一对神奇的伙伴,它们共同守护着你的数字资产。

公钥的公开性

公钥的公开性,使得任何人都可以查看你的资产。但是,由于私钥的保密性,你的资产仍然安全。

私钥的保密性

私钥的保密性,是数字世界安全的基石。只有你拥有私钥,才能控制你的资产。

地址的唯一性

地址的唯一性,确保了你的资产不会被混淆。每个地址,都对应着唯一的资产。

公私钥的应用场景

公私钥,不仅仅局限于以太坊,它们在数字世界的各个角落都有应用。

加密通信

公私钥可以用于加密通信,确保你的信息不被泄露。

数字签名

公私钥可以用于数字签名,确保你的签名真实有效。

数字身份认证

公私钥可以用于数字身份认证,确保你的身份不被冒用。

在这个数字化的时代,公私钥就像一把神奇的钥匙,打开了数字世界的宝库。它们守护着我们的资产,确保我们的安全。让我们一起,探索这个神秘的世界,掌握这把神奇的钥匙,开启属于我们的数字时代。


玩家评论

此处添加你的第三方评论代码